Output 23f3b9c96867c29fe8446753c4440a52ef19aeba3cac6c441f9523cc515ce925:6

value
1742401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 889c1661481828340ff8a5eecb23d3ede351ad18 OP_EQUALVERIFY OP_CHECKSIG
address
1DTKtEXHBRTsd1HGsmXzjDaZ7TdS1oZSFf
transaction
23f3b9c96867c29fe8446753c4440a52ef19aeba3cac6c441f9523cc515ce925
spent
true